Training Department 973 - Robotic Welding Instructor - 1st Shift

QP Training (D973) is currently looking for an organized, self-motivated Robotic Welding Instructor for the Training School. This position will report to the Supervisor of the Weld School and play an integral role in the training and qualification of Robotic welding students.

The Instructor will be part of a team, responsible for the training of students in specific courses related to general safety, Robotic welding, as well as additional Robotic welding related requirements. Qualified candidates will have a strong sense of commitment to Safety and Procedure Compliance, be a self-starter and possess strong verbal & written communication skills. Candidates must also possess the ability to multi-task with a friendly, approachable customer service demeanor.
